COVID vaccine vial Much of their resistance to COVID vaccines is philosophical — 70% are opposed to vaccines in general — but 19% don't trust the government's role in administering the vaccine.

Thirty percent of workers say they will wait and see others fare with the COVID-19 vaccine before getting vaccinated themselves, according to a new survey by Buck, a benefits consulting and tech firm. Their reasons, though, show that managers who want to encourage their teams to get vaccinated face a complex challenge that requires dynamic messaging to address workers' varied concerns.
